Google Play Custom App Publishing API 適合用於企業行動 管理服務供應商 (EMM)、第三方應用程式開發人員和其他機構 想讓企業客戶發布私人應用程式 (以及 稱為自訂應用程式)。
企業客戶是指透過 Google Play 管理版發布工作的機構 提供給員工的應用程式每個企業客戶都需自行維護 Google Play 管理版商店,其中包含 公開和私人應用程式私人應用程式 不適用於企業以外的使用者,只有能存取 企業的 Google Play 管理版商店可以查看及安裝私人應用程式。
初始設定
使用 Google Play Custom App Publishing API 發布私人應用程式前, 就必須先為專案啟用 Google Play Custom App Publishing API 建立服務帳戶,並透過 Play 管理中心開發人員帳戶將發布權限授予這個帳戶。
啟用 Google Play Custom App Publishing API
如要為專案啟用 Google Play Custom App Publishing API,請按照下列步驟操作 步驟:
開啟 Google API 控制台。如果沒有 Google 帳戶,請選取 更多選項 >建立帳戶,然後填寫表單來建立 讓他們使用服務帳戶如果您有 Google 帳戶,請在系統提示時登入。
在專案清單中選取專案或建立專案。
搜尋 Google Play Custom App Publishing API 的 API 程式庫。目的地: 啟用 API,選取該 API,然後按一下「啟用」。
建立服務帳戶
使用已啟用 Google Play Custom App Publishing API 的相同專案時,請按照下列步驟建立服務帳戶:
開啟 Google API 控制台。如果出現提示,請登入帳戶。
從專案清單中,選擇您在啟用 API 時選取或建立的專案。
在主選單中選取「IAM &」(身分與存取權管理與)管理 >服務帳戶 >建立服務帳戶。
輸入服務帳戶的名稱,然後選取「提供一組新的私密金鑰」。然後按一下「建立」。
記下服務帳戶的電子郵件地址,並儲存服務帳戶的 私密金鑰檔案必須存放在應用程式可存取的位置。您的應用程式 必須加以授權才能對 Google Play Custom App Publishing API 發出授權呼叫。
將發布權限授予服務帳戶
如要將發布權限授予您建立的服務帳戶,請按照下列步驟操作:
開啟 Play 管理中心。
選取現有的開發人員帳戶或建立新帳戶。
按照「授予使用者存取權」文件中的步驟,授予透過服務帳戶電子郵件地址建立及發布私人應用程式的權限。
擷取開發人員帳戶 ID
完成設定和權限程序後,請記下 Play 管理中心網址中的開發人員帳戶 ID:
https://play.google.com/console/developers/123456
務必將開發人員帳戶 ID 做為參數傳遞 為使用者的發布私人應用程式 企業。